Pretty crazy auction for this pair of the Air Aloha, we post earlier a darker pair of them but forgot what they are officially called. This colorway is the famous one. The auction says this:

Here is the Nike Air Aloha, that originally released all the way back in 1984, to commemorate the Honolulu Marathon. Brother of the Air Guam. Beyond that, I dont know much about the history of these beauties.

To add to the rarity, this particular pair of running shoes was autographed by The Beach Boys lead singer, Mike Love who was an original member of the group.
